/ Forside / Teknologi / Operativsystemer / Linux /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
Linux
#NavnPoint
o.v.n. 11177
peque 7911
dk 4814
e.c 2359
Uranus 1334
emesen 1334
stone47 1307
linuxrules 1214
Octon 1100
10  BjarneD 875
postgresql vil ikke starte
Fra : Lars Bonde


Dato : 12-01-04 16:58

Jeg her en RH7.3 som jeg jeg her en Postgresql server på og til den her jeg
SQL-Ledger. Det har virket uden problemer men nu man skal til at lever
årsregnskab og så går det galt.

Min postgresql server vil ikke starte. Når jeg starte den skriver den Failed
og ikke andet. jeg her prøvet at fjerne og genindtaler postgresql men lige
megen hjælper det. Jeg kan ikke finde noget i logfilerne om hvad der går
galt. ( jeg her backup )

er der nogle der her en bud???
VH

Lars
--
Lars Bonde
Email lars@casiopeia.net.fjern
http://www.klintehuset.dk



 
 
Troels Arvin (12-01-2004)
Kommentar
Fra : Troels Arvin


Dato : 12-01-04 20:10

On Mon, 12 Jan 2004 16:57:49 +0100, Lars Bonde wrote:

> Jeg kan ikke finde noget i logfilerne om hvad der går
> galt.

PostgreSQL's init-script på Red Hat er lidt fjollet, idet visse
fejlmeddelelser smides ud i det blå. Prøv at gå til /etc/init.d og
editér filen postgresql. Find en linje, hvor der står noget i stil med

su -l postgres ... pg_ctl ... start > /dev/null 2>&1 ...

Prøv at erstatte "> /dev/null" med "> /tmp/postgresql-out". Du vil da
sandsynligvis kunne se noget informativt i /tmp/postgresql out efter
forsøg på at starte postgresql.

--
Greetings from Troels Arvin, Copenhagen, Denmark


Lars Bonde (13-01-2004)
Kommentar
Fra : Lars Bonde


Dato : 13-01-04 01:13


"Troels Arvin" <troels@arvin.dk> skrev i en meddelelse
news:pan.2004.01.12.19.10.27.570365@arvin.dk...

> PostgreSQL's init-script på Red Hat er lidt fjollet, idet visse
> fejlmeddelelser smides ud i det blå. Prøv at gå til /etc/init.d og
> editér filen postgresql. Find en linje, hvor der står noget i stil med
>
> su -l postgres ... pg_ctl ... start > /dev/null 2>&1 ...
>
> Prøv at erstatte "> /dev/null" med "> /tmp/postgresql-out".

Mange tak.
Jeg får følgende log

pg_ctl: Another postmaster may be running. Trying to start postmaster
anyway.
Found a pre-existing shared memory block (ID 131076) still in use.
If you're sure there are no old backends still running,
remove the shared memory block with ipcrm(1), or just
delete "/var/lib/pgsql/data/postmaster.pid".
pg_ctl: cannot start postmaster
Examine the log output.
~
den forstår jeg ikke helt. I /var/lib/pgsql er der ikke nogen mappe /data/
og en søgning på
postmaster.pid gav intet resultalt.

Så jeg er stadig på bar bund.

Lars



Troels Arvin (13-01-2004)
Kommentar
Fra : Troels Arvin


Dato : 13-01-04 08:56

On Tue, 13 Jan 2004 01:12:42 +0100, Lars Bonde wrote:
> I /var/lib/pgsql er der ikke nogen mappe /data/
> og en søgning på
> postmaster.pid gav intet resultalt.

Det var sært. Det lyder som om, at din "postgresql-server" pakke ikke er
intakt. Hvordan er din PostgreSQL installeret? - Er der tale om en
installation fra Red Hat's RPM'er, eller har du selv kompileret osv.?

--
Greetings from Troels Arvin, Copenhagen, Denmark


Lars Bonde (13-01-2004)
Kommentar
Fra : Lars Bonde


Dato : 13-01-04 15:11


"Troels Arvin" <troels@arvin.dk> skrev i en meddelelse
news:pan.2004.01.13.07.56.09.251911@arvin.dk...

>
> Det var sært. Det lyder som om, at din "postgresql-server" pakke ikke er
> intakt. Hvordan er din PostgreSQL installeret? - Er der tale om en
> installation fra Red Hat's RPM'er, eller har du selv kompileret osv.?

Der er tale om RPM fra Redhat
postgresql-libs-7.2.1-5.i386.rpm
postgresql-7.2.1-5.i386.rpm
postgresql-server-7.2.1-5.i386.rpm
postgresql-devel-7.2.1-5.i386.rpm

Det skulle være det. Jeg har lige prøvet at hente dem på Redhat igen og så
ud og så ind igen. Det er stadig det samme.
Lars



Søg
Reklame
Statistik
Spørgsmål : 177559
Tips : 31968
Nyheder : 719565
Indlæg : 6408938
Brugere : 218888

Månedens bedste
Årets bedste
Sidste års bedste